Obituary for Nelta Mae Law
Nelta (Kelley) Law, 74, of Altus, passed away at her home Saturday, March 15, 2008.
Nelta was born April 23, 1933, to Clovis and Esther Mae (Lanning) Kelley in Olustee, Oklahoma, where she was raised. She attended school in Olustee from first thtough twelfth grade. After graduation, she attended Lippert Business School in Wichita Falls, Texas, and then went on to Wayland Baptist College. Her interest in business and computers was what she loved doing. She was employed as Association Executive Officer for the Altus Board of Realtors from 1983 to 2008. She was awarded many awards, but the highest honor that was bestowed upon her was by the Oklahoma Association of Realtors as a member of Omega Tare RHO Fraternity. She was a member of the Altus Association of Realtors, Oklahoma Association of Realtors, and Ladies Auxiliary of the VFW Post 4876.
She loved to spend time with family, realtor friends and traveling. In December of 1961 she married Carl Law and spent 40 years with him until his death in January 2002.
Nelta is survived by three sons, Kevin Law and wife Roben of Altus; Robert Law and wife Sherry of Oklahoma City and Mike Law of Oklahoma City; one daughter, Debbie Freeze and husband Gary of Altus; grandchildren, Kyle Law and wife Stacie of Altus, Karissa Heron and husband Tom of Oklahoma City, Mellissa Law of Oklahoma City, Brandi Law of Oklahoma City, Dustin Law of Oklahoma City, Ashly Kooken of Edmond, Holly Kooken of Altus, Justin Freeze and Brandon Freeze, both of Altus; four great-grandchildren, Michael Heron, Mason Law, Lucas Peele and Sydney Heron; and all of her Realtor friends.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Carl; parents, Clovis and Esther Kelley; one sister, Rowena Porter; one brother, Clinton Kelley and one precious grandson, John Mark Pierce.
Funeral Services for Nelta Law will be held 10:00 a.m., Tuesday, March 18,2008, at Lowell-Tims Funeral Chapel with Bill Osborne officiating. Interment will follow at Altus City Cemetery under the direction of the Lowell-Tims Funeral Home.
